Those Warren-Cowley parameters have been determined in situ above the order-disorder transition temperature by diffuse neutron scattering. From these experimentally determined static correlations, the first nine effective pair interactions have been deduced using inverse Monte Carlo simulations. [Pg.32]

It is also of interest to obtain information on changes of short-range order (SRO) during irradiation as well as of long-range order (LRO). The state of SRO is usually given by the Cowley-Warren parameters a, that describe the conditional probability (P ba) finding B (A) atoms on the successive coordination shells around A (B) atoms, and which have the form... [Pg.158]
